Valspar

Intrigue

T522

Intrigue is a smoky lavender-gray, not a clean purple. Its gray base keeps it grounded. Use it in a bedroom, dressing area, or powder room when softness needs a little shadow.

Next to bright white, the violet shows more. Beside taupe fabrics, it becomes quieter. Avoid yellowed trim unless the sample still looks intentional, because warm whites can make the purple seem dusty.

Intrigue in Different Light

Light temperature is measured in Kelvin: a warm 2700K bulb pulls colors toward yellow, while 5000K daylight reads cooler and truer. Check the color at the time of day you actually use the room.

LRV measures how much light a color reflects, from 0 (black) to 100 (pure white). Below about 50 a color needs good lighting to avoid going flat, 60 and up helps brighten a room, and most whites sit above 80.
